Question

3. How would the calculated concentration of the NaOH) determined by you compare to the true concentration of the NaOH(a) if the KHP had not been fully dried before use? If this were the case, what impact would this have on your acid? calculated molar mass of the unknown 4. How would the calculated concentration of the NaOHae) determined by you compare to the true concentration of the NaOH(ag) if an air bubble had been present in the buret? If this were the case, what impact would this have on your calculated molar mass of the unknown acid?

Explanation / Answer

1. If KHP was not fully dried before maing the primary standard solution. The actual amount of KHP in solution would be lower than the calculated value and thus lower volume of NaOH would be used for the titration. theretical moles of KHP is higher (incorrect) and would give higher moles of NaOH, therefore higher molarity of NaOH than actual value would be calculated in this experiment. The molar mass of unknown acid calculate from this NaOH solution would be then lower than actual value as moles of acid calculate from moles of NaOH used is higher.

2. If air bubble is present in buret, the net volume of NaOH added is calculate higher than actual valie added. moles of NaOH thus obtained is gretaer than true value and molarity of NaOH would be higher. The molar mass of unknown acid thus calculate would also be lower than actual value as moles of acid obtained from moles of NaOH is higher.
